Ingredient Function and Why It Matters
Effective hair repair relies on a combination of protein for internal cohesion, moisture-binding humectants, and emollient oils that reduce friction and support shine. Briogeo Don't Despair Repair Deep Conditioning Hair Mask includes hydrolyzed plant protein, rosehip oil, algae extract, and marshmallow root to address multiple aspects of hair health. These ingredients work together to improve elasticity, reduce breakage, and support a smoother cuticle layer when used consistently and correctly.
Key Ingredients and Their Documented Roles
- Hydrolyzed plant protein: Helps patch gaps in the hair cortex, improving tensile strength and reducing breakage when used in moderate, repeated applications.
- Rosehip oil: Provides essential fatty acids and antioxidant compounds that support moisture retention and scalp barrier health over time.
- Algae extract: Delivers minerals and humectant molecules that enhance flexibility and moisture uptake during and after styling.
- Marshmallow root: Offers gentle conditioning and film-forming properties that smooth the cuticle without heavy buildup.
How to Incorporate the Mask Into a Routine
Correct application and timing are more important than frequency when using a deep conditioning mask. Applying this mask to clean, damp hair allows better penetration of humectants and proteins. Covering with heat or steam can increase ingredient absorption, but moderation is important to prevent hygral fatigue. Following with a light sealing oil or butter can lock in hydration, while avoiding heavy protein stacking helps maintain hair flexibility.
Practical Application Steps
- Shampoo hair to remove excess buildup, or co-wash if following a low-poo approach.
- Apply Briogeo Don't Despair Repair Deep Conditioning Hair Mask from mid-length to ends, and lightly on the mid-scalp if needed.
- Section hair to ensure even coverage, then comb through for distribution.
- Cover with a shower cap or warm towel, optionally use a low-heat dryer for 10–20 minutes.
- Rinse thoroughly until water runs clear, then proceed with a gentle conditioner or leave-in if necessary.

Practical Usage Guidance at a Glance
| Aspect | Guidance | Context or Note |
|---|---|---|
| Frequency | Once per week or every 10–14 days | Adjust based on porosity, protein sensitivity, and ongoing damage. |
| Application focus | Mid-length to ends, light coverage on mid-scalp | Fine or low-porosity hair may benefit from reduced scalp application. |
| Heat use | Optional, low to moderate heat under a cap | Heat can improve penetration but may increase hygral stress if overused. |
| Rinsing | Until water runs clear, typically 1–3 minutes | Incomplete removal can lead to buildup and limpness. |
| Pairing with protein | Avoid stacking multiple protein treatments in one week | Balance protein and moisture to maintain elasticity. |
